How they compare

Small states currently reports 121,470 against 75,929 in United Arab Emirates, a difference of 45,541.

That makes Small states's figure about 1.6 times United Arab Emirates's.

Across all 22 years both countries report, Small states has been ahead every year.

Small states ranks 40th and United Arab Emirates ranks 43rd of 43 groups.

Small states has averaged higher in every one of the 5 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Small states United Arab Emirates Difference Ahead
1970s 40,128 894 39,234 Small states
1980s 45,755 2,144 43,611 Small states
1990s 57,086 5,561 51,526 Small states
2010s 112,357 47,462 64,896 Small states
2020s 118,480 66,468 52,012 Small states

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
